查询实例恢复记录
功能介绍
查询指定缓存实例的恢复记录列表。
URI
GET /v1.0/{project_id}/instances/{instance_id}/restores?start={start}&limit={limit}&beginTime={beginTime}&endTime={endTime}
参数 |
类型 |
必选 |
说明 |
---|---|---|---|
project_id |
String |
是 |
项目ID。获取方式,参考获取项目ID。 |
instance_id |
String |
是 |
实例ID。 |
start |
Integer |
否 |
待查询的恢复记录的起始序号,默认起始序号为1。 |
limit |
Integer |
否 |
每页显示条数,最小值为1,若不设置该参数,默认显示10条。 |
beginTime |
String |
否 |
查询开始时间。格式:yyyyMMddHHmmss,如:20170718235959。 |
endTime |
String |
否 |
查询结束时间。格式:yyyyMMddHHmmss,如:20170718235959。 |
请求消息
请求参数
无
请求示例
GET https://{dcs_endpoint}/v1.0/{project_id}/instances/{instance_id}/restores?start={start}&limit={limit}&beginTime={beginTime}&endTime={endTime}
响应消息
响应参数
参数 |
类型 |
说明 |
---|---|---|
status |
String |
恢复状态。
|
progress |
String |
恢复进度。 |
restore_id |
String |
恢复记录ID。 |
backup_id |
String |
备份ID。 |
restore_remark |
String |
恢复备注信息。 |
backup_remark |
String |
备份备注信息。 |
created_at |
String |
恢复任务创建时间。 |
updated_at |
String |
恢复完成时间。 |
restore_name |
String |
恢复记录名称。 |
backup_name |
String |
备份记录名称。 |
error_code |
String |
恢复失败后错误码,参见表4。 |
{ "restore_record_response": [ { "status": "succeed", "progress": "100.00", "restore_id": "a6155972-800c-4170-a479-3231e907d2f6", "backup_id": "f4823e9e-fe9b-4ffd-be79-4e5d6de272bb", "restore_remark": "doctest", "backup_remark": null, "created_at": "2017-07-18T21:41:20.721Z", "updated_at": "2017-07-18T21:41:35.182Z", "restore_name": "restore_20170718214120", "backup_name": "backup_20170718000002", "sourceInstanceId":"dcb96c22-fd6f-41c0-88b5-544784558dd9", "sourceInstanceName":"Test-DCS-MS-3-f79a983f", "error_code": null } ], "total_num": 1 }